How enterprises can now start deploying asymmetric mobile and physical access credentials at scale

Enterprises can now deploy open standard mobile and physical credentials secured with asymmetric cryptography at scale. Previously limited by complex, one-by-one provisioning, public-key access credentials are now scalable via the Public Key Open Credential (PKOC) mass enrollment service for enterprises. This advancement allows organizations to improve security, streamline administration, and support both mobile and physical credentials without reissuing access when systems change, marking a major step forward in enterprise access credentialing.

A short guide to app-less visitor passes

Visitors no longer need to download another mobile app just to gain temporary access to a building. With Sentry Interactive app-less digital visitor passes, guests receive a secure access link directly via email, allowing them to use a web-based QR code scanner to unlock authorised doors using time-limited permissions. The result is a faster, simpler, and more seamless visitor experience without the hassle of physical passes or app installations.
